I am the President of the Victorian Branch of the Vietnam Veterans Association of Australia.

On 18 August-our Vietnam Veterans Day here-my branch will be conducting a special commemorative service at the Melbourne Shrine of Remembrance to commemorate the 50th anniversary of the deployment of the 1RAR Group to Vietnam which was attached to the US 173rd Airborne Brigade.

An important part of that deployment was the 161 Fd Bty RNZA, and I wanted to make sure that your folk knew that we are remembering and commemorating their service in Vietnam with 1RAR Group.
